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9540658715 86819623 04 51186
57871677305 80209 36793419807
57871677305 80209 36793419807
69795930 26 67376 47676 129858
All about undefined
Interested in learning more?
57871677305 80209 36793419807
69795930 26 67376 47676 129858
See more
8096 39210493293 4947
991761 11545 1159
See more
878 711399376
4940 779772 640794 351 96541923369
See more